Coronado Unified School District was found negligent in the hiring, supervision, retention of Jordan Bucklew, who admitted to a felony sex crime with a student basketball player

A San Diego jury on Monday found Coronado Unified School District negligent in the employment of an assistant girls basketball coach who pleaded guilty to having a sexual relationship with one of his players and awarded the former student $5 million in damages. The civil trial, which concluded testimony and arguments last week, centered around the employment of Jordan Tyler Bucklew. He pleaded guilty in 2020 to a felony count of unlawful sex with a minor.

Coronado police arrested Bucklew, now 38, in February 2020 on suspicion that he was having a sexual relationship with a student who played on the basketball team. In December of that year, after pleading guilty to the felony charge, a San Diego judge sentenced Bucklew to three years of probation but did not require him to register as a sex offender.
